A DAY FOR ASSUMPTIONIST FAMILIES AND CLOSE FRIENDS PDF Print E-mail

On Sunday, April 29, 2012,  the Assumptionists invited their families and close friends for an informal gathering at Assumption College. We celebrated the Eucharist and then enjoyed a plentiful brunch.

Although this event coincided with the Dedication of the new Tinsley Campus Ministry Center, the objective was simply to provide an occasion to be with those we care for and who care for us.  We rarely have such an opportunity to share in this way and to thank those dear to us for their love and support.

Of course, there are many others who also love and support us in so many ways through shared ministry and professional work. But this gathering was meant to solidify the bonds of family and personal friendship.

This was the second such gathering.  Can we consider it a "tradition"?

Fr. Claude Grenache, A.A.
